Olympiacos want Barcelona’s Alex Koyados, according to SPORT
In the last few hours in Spain, Spanish winger and Barcelona attacking midfielder Alex Coyado has again been linked with Olympiacos.
Olympiacos had scouted Barcelona’s intentions for him last summer Alex Koyadobut the Catalans then preferred to loan the player out to Elche to keep a closer eye on him.
However, in the last few hours in Spain, the Spanish winger and attacking midfielder has been linked again with the Red and Whites, while it has also been stressed that Sassuolo has also expressed an interest in his acquisition.
Coyado failed to earn a spot in Barcelona’s squad last summer and was loaned out to Elche to set up games.
The 23-year-old forward has featured in 10 league and cup games, recording one goal and one assist in the first half of the season. According to a report from Catalan outlet SPORT, his loan deal could be terminated as Olympiacos Sassuolo.
According to the Spaniards, Kogiado can be loaned out to either the Greek champions or the Italian side “He’s considering a change of country in the winter transfer window, even a country, to increase his appearances and performance. The footballer, who is represented by Alex Botines and managerial agency Goal Management, will take a few days to decide on his future.”
Alex Coyado played for Barcelona in friendlies against Juventus and Inter Miami last summer and extended his contract with the Catalans until June 2024 before being loaned out to Elche. The latter committed to taking on 50% of his annual contract, but no purchase option was specified.
The Spanish winger is a product of Barcelona’s academies, with whom he has made two first-team appearances and has been on loan at Granada and Elche.
